Abstract:
Prosocial behavior play a significant role during global crises. Furthermore, positive behaviors, such as empathy and social responsibility, can alleviate the severity stressful events. The current study investigated these positive behaviors and their role in developing prosocial behavior during COVID pandemic in 381 university undergraduate students at King Saud University in Saudi Arabia. To measure social responsibility, empathy and prosocial behavior, the researcher has used Social Responsibility Scale, Toronto Empathy Questionnaire, and Prosocial Behavior Scale. The t-test, the Pearson correlation coefficient, and Macro program Process have used to analyze the links between the research variables prosocial behavior, social responsibility, and empathy. In relation to the pandemic, social responsibility and empathy were associated with prosocial behavior. Moreover, empathy mediated the association between social responsibility and prosocial behavior. Furthermore, men had higher prosocial behavior and social responsibility then women while, women had higher empathy then men. Our results offer new insights into the roles that positive factors play in improving the mental health of university students during pandemics situation.
